Women and Writing in Medieval Europe: A Sourcebook

"Women and Writing in Medieval Europe: A Sourcebook," published by Taylor & Francis Ltd in 1995, is an essential resource for anyone interested in the literary contributions of women throughout the medieval period. This comprehensive collection spans 1,000 years and includes a diverse range of literary, historical, and theological writings from women across Europe, from Iceland to Byzantium. With 292 pages of primary texts, this sourcebook brings to light the voices and perspectives of medieval women, showcasing their pivotal roles in shaping the cultural and intellectual landscape of their time. Perfect for scholars, students, and those passionate about women's history, this meticulously curated volume offers a deeper understanding of the complexities of women's experiences and contributions in medieval Europe.
